Teso de la Muerta
Teso de la Muerta is a locality in Roelos de Sayago, Zamora, Castile and León. Teso de la Muerta is situated nearby to the locality Valdelara, as well as near Pallinero.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Monleras is a municipality located in the Northwest of the province of Salamanca, Castile and León, Spain, near the Tormes river. According to the 2024 census, the municipality has a population of 245 inhabitants.

Villaseco de los Reyes is a village and particularly large municipality in the province of Salamanca, western Spain, part of the autonomous community of Castile-Leon. Villaseco de los Reyes is situated 5 km southeast of Teso de la Muerta.

Sardón de los Frailes is a municipality located in the province of Salamanca, Castile and León, Spain. As of 2016 the municipality has a population of 82 inhabitants. Sardón de los Frailes is situated 5 km west of Teso de la Muerta.
